The LG UltraGear OLED GX7 27-inch QHD gaming monitor redefines competitive gaming with a blistering 480Hz refresh rate and ultra-fast 0.03ms response time. Featuring OLED technology with 98.5% DCI-P3 color accuracy, DisplayHDR True Black 400, and MLA+ brightness enhancement up to 1300 nits, it delivers breathtaking visuals with deep blacks and vivid colors. Equipped with DisplayPort 2.1 and AMD FreeSync Premium Pro plus NVIDIA G-SYNC compatibility, it ensures tear-free, ultra-smooth gameplay. Its ergonomic adjustable stand and anti-glare screen make it a perfect centerpiece for any pro gamer’s setup, while advanced calibration tools support content creators seeking color precision.

A great, responsive OLED, but update the firmware and settings
I chose this LG UltraGear as my new main monitor, specifically opting for a WOLED panel over a QD-OLED. My desk is next to a large window, so I wanted a monitor with a matte screen that could handle reflections well for both work during the day and gaming at night, and this has been the perfect choice for that scenario. Coming from what was a fairly high-end IPS display when it released, the leap to OLED is staggering. It is a huge improvement in every single regard: the colours are significantly richer, the inky blacks are truly perfect, and the responsiveness is on another level. For gaming, this monitor is simply impressive. The incredible refresh rate makes competitive games feel exceptionally fluid, while the perfect contrast ratio is a game-changer for darker, atmospheric horror games. The experience extends to media, too. Watching HDR Blu-rays on this display is a treat; the visuals are so impressive that they even surpass my main TV. The inclusion of DisplayPort 2.1 is also a great touch for future-proofing. However, it's important to address the software. Many of the reported launch issues, like the poor 60Hz responsiveness, have been fixed via firmware updates and hopefully more improvements will come in the future. The update process is easy enough, though the PC application you use feels clunky and has some poor translations. More importantly, I would strongly recommend new owners dive into the settings immediately. The default picture mode has an adaptive brightness that can make the screen unreadably dim at random moments. Switching to a different mode and making a few tweaks makes a world of difference.
